Judge Richard Posner talked about his book The Little Book of Plagiarism, published by Pantheon. He discussed contemporary notions of plagiarism, intellectual property, and fair use in literature, music, art, film, and academia with Jonathan Lethem. Mr. Lethem, an award-winning novelist, is the author of the recent Harper’s Magazine essay about plagiarism “The Ecstasy of Influence.” The conversation was moderated by Lawrence Weschler, author of Everything that Rises: A Book of Convergences, nominated for the 2006 National Book Critics Circle Award for Criticism. close
